In a previous question, I inquired about trusts/wills.  Took Google's
advice, went to county records and looked up the information.   Is
there a way to find if the current will on file with the county has
been revised or if there was an earlier will filed?

You would have to ask at the county level if they keep a detailed
record as to whether an earlier will would have been kept on file. 
Most likely, the answer would be no, since the newer will
automatically voids the older will and there would be no reason for
the older will to be kept and anyway wills are private documents that
are kept by the owner.
